Urine for wealth: Producing organic fertilizers from human waste as a viable enterprise for the urban poor, Lilongwe City Council

Malawi is an agro-based economy with crops as amajor farm enterprise.All along the country has depended on imported chemical fertilizers.In the work of economic crisis,the acqusition of chemical fertlizers from outside is proving unsustainable that demends the much-needed foreign currency.Worse still the chemical fertilizers have impacted negatively on the environment by triggering soil acidity killing the soil microbes and rendering the soils infrtile for crop production.Therefore the organic fertilizers are providing a cheap and sustainable alternative to chemical fertilizers for crop production.

Objectives:
1.To improve management of wastes in public markets
2.To provide new waste collection and handling facilities within the public market.
3.To icrease incomes for the urban poor through market linkages for waste-based products.
4.To demonstrate the application and market the organic fertilizers.
